| | Definition: | |
- [n] a Scandinavian language that is spoken in Norway
- [n] a native or inhabitant of Norway
- [adj] of or relating to Norway or its people or culture or language; "Norwegian herring"

Webster's 1913 Dictionary |
| |
| | Definition: | |
\Nor*we"gi*an\, a. [Cf. Icel. Noregr, Norvegr, Norway.
See {North}, and {Way}.]
Of or pertaining to Norway, its inhabitants, or its language.
\Nor*we"gi*an\, n.
1. A native of Norway.
2. That branch of the Scandinavian language spoken in Norway.
